Albuquerque Station Denies Accusations Former Photographer Helped Current Governor Cheat in 2018 Debate

By Kevin Eck 

Albuquerque, N.M. NBC affiliate KOB is denying accusations a former employee helped New Mexico Governor Michelle Lujan Grisham in a debate during the 2018 campaign.

In a series of tweets from attorney Thomas Grover and in a press release from current republican candidate for governor Mark Ronchetti, the two allege former KOB photographer Joseph Lynch gave the state’s Democratic governor the questions used in the debate when she was first elected governor back in 2018. Grover said the text messages were sent to him anonymously.

Ronchetti left his job as chief meteorologist at Albuquerque station KRQE in 2021 to run for governor.

Saying the station takes allegations like this “very seriously,” gm Michelle Donaldson denied the accusations. KOB started its Thursday evening newscast with the story and called Lynch for comment, but hasn’t heard back. Lynch left the station two years ago.

“For over 70 years, KOB-TV has adhered to the highest standards of journalism integrity and would never engage in behavior that would undermine our standards, the respect of our viewers, or the public trust,” said Donaldson. “We actively invite the Ronchetti campaign and the alleged anonymous source to contact KOB-TV and share all relevant evidence so we can fully investigate these allegations and maintain our commitment to transparency and the high standards we have set for the people we serve in New Mexico.”

In a press release, Ronchetti attached screenshots of the alleged text messages Lynch sent the Lujan Grisham campaign two weeks before the 2018 debate detailing how it would unfold and saying he wanted to help Lujan Grisham “in any way I can.”

“These bombshell text messages show that Michelle Lujan Grisham will brazenly cheat and deceive New Mexicans in order to attain and hold onto her power,” said Ronchetti, who added “This governor is corrupt to the core and must be held accountable.”
